在Web开发中,我们经常需要使用视频和音频元素来展示多媒体内容。当用户在浏览器中播放视频或音频时,可能会遇到一些意外情况,比如网络连接问题或用户手动中止播放。为了更好地处理这些情况,我们可以使用onabort
事件来监听用户中止播放操作。
什么是onabort事件
onabort
事件在视频和音频元素中是一个事件处理程序,当用户手动中止播放时,会触发这个事件。通过监听onabort
事件,我们可以捕获用户中止播放操作,并做出相应的处理。
如何使用onabort事件
要使用onabort
事件,我们首先需要获取视频或音频元素,并为其添加事件监听器。下面是一个简单的示例代码:
-- -------------------- ---- ------- ------ ------------ --------- ------- --------------- ----------------- ---- ------- ---- --- ------- --- ----- ---- -------- -------- ----- ----- - ----------------------------------- ------------- - ---------- - ----------------- -- ---------
在上面的示例中,我们首先获取了id为myVideo
的视频元素,并为其添加了一个onabort
事件处理程序。当用户手动中止视频播放时,会弹出一个提示框显示"视频播放已中止"。
类似地,我们也可以使用onabort
事件来监听音频元素的中止操作。下面是一个音频元素的示例代码:
-- -------------------- ---- ------- ------ ------------ --------- ------- --------------- ----------------- ---- ------- ---- --- ------- --- ----- ---- -------- -------- ----- ----- - ----------------------------------- ------------- - ---------- - ----------------- -- ---------
总结
通过使用onabort
事件,我们可以更好地处理用户中止视频和音频播放的情况,提高用户体验。希望本文能帮助你更好地理解和使用onabort
事件。